Best tractor or utility vehicle for kids
OK, perhaps this is a bit off topic here. My daughter will be turning four this summer, and one of the things she wants for her birthday is a tractor or utility vehicle of some kind. I'm talking about the ones made for little kids that run on batteries. She has a little Cub Cadet tractor that she got for her second birthday, and while she hasn't outgrown it yet, she will soon.
So, what I'm wondering is if there are any vehicles out there that are more obscure than the typical ones you'd find at Toys r Us and the like. It seems most of the "mainstream" vehicles out there all have plastic wheels. Does anyone know of any lesser known companies that make similar vehicles for kids that are perhaps a bit more rugged and capable? We live on a very hilly property, so traction is often an issue for her on the Cub Cadet. And she's still a few years away from anything gas powered, like a little ATV.

Re: Best tractor or utility vehicle for kids
I just love the razor quad. Rubber, air filled tires, 12 volt battery, climbs hills, runs continuously over an hour. I think it run about 12 mph, which was a good speed for my four year old once she got used to it. She's still riding it now at 6 years old. She can ride along side her older sisters china quad in the mud etc but not as fast. I did have to replace the 70 dollar battery once since I've had it. I think you can get the razor on sale most of the time for between 3 and 4 hundred at Walmart and online.

Re: Best tractor or utility vehicle for kids
My son has had a Gator since he was 3 or 4. The company that makes them sells replacement parts and is great to deal with. They offer phone support and help trouble shoot problems. He's used it HARD, hauling full heaping loads of mulch, sod, brick, crushed stone, soil. But he does take care of it, and it has never been left out in the weather. That Gator should not be alive, but it still is. We've replaced several parts including wheel motors, switches, wheels, etc etc. He's now 11, and while he can't fit on it anymore, he still plays with it all the time. He plays Mechanic with it. He jacks it up and removes the wheels to flip them as they wear. Removes the seats, bed, etc.. Winches it off the floor to perform all sorts of "repairs" while I'm in the shop working. It was the best money we ever spent on a toy, and I can't say enough about the Gator. I've looked all over for a step up from that plastic toy, with no luck. I think the next step is a small golf cart with a bed.
